Cost of Living in Rome vs Stuttgart

Cost of living in Rome is 22% lower than in Stuttgart (without rent).

Rent in Rome is 3% cheaper than in Stuttgart.

Cost of living including rent in Rome is 11% lower than in Stuttgart.

Food in Rome is 14% cheaper than in Stuttgart.

Transport in Rome is 67% cheaper than in Stuttgart.
